摘要
Although there is limited direct evidence on the relationship between diet and frailty, indirect evidence suggests that optimal nutrition may contribute to the prevention of frailty by decreasing the incidence of CHD, stroke, and type 2 diabetes. Greater intake of vitamin D will reduce risks of falls and fractures among elderly individuals, and other benefits are possible. Higher intakes of B vitamins, dietary carotenoids, and omega-three fatty acids may be important for the prevention of frailty among older persons, but further research is needed. A reasonable diet for most persons would emphasize monounsaturated and polyunsaturated fats, whole grains, and an abundant intake of fruits and vegetables, and would minimize consumption of saturated and trans fatty acids, sugar, and refined starches. A vitamin D supplement that contains 800 to 1000 IU daily would be generally desirable. Relatively few persons consume such a diet, which presents a challenge for researchers and those who care for elderly patients. Copyright 2006 by The Gerontological Society of America.
